New Training: Getting Started with MX Firewalls
In this 26-video, entry-level training, CBT Nuggets trainer Knox Hutchinson covers the knowledge that network administrators need to configure, administer and troubleshoot Cisco Meraki MX Security & SD-WAN appliances in the administration of distributed sites, campuses or datacenter VPNs.

The Meraki MX line of firewall appliances from Cisco are some of the most popular security and virtualization tools on the market. Companies that invest in the use of Meraki MXs also need network administrators who go out of their way to learn to master them.
The four skills that comprise this training are:
- Understand Cisco Meraki Cloud Networking Concepts
- Deploy LAN Connectivity with Meraki MX Appliances
- Implement Advanced Security Features with Meraki MX Firewalls
- Deploy VPNs with Cisco Meraki MX Firewalls
The four-part series covers topics such as setting bandwidth policies for different application types, filtering content and preventing intrusions, and automating VPN route generations as well as:
- Creating Users for Client VPNs
- Addressing and VLANs
- Summarizing Meraki Firewall Features
- Setting the Primary and Failover WAN IP Addresses
- Inbound Firewall Rules
